Output 24012b32bc43096e58a8af882bd2e2a43c0cf2448ee739998eb7ecf3994e3cf1:23

value
86624101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d2ec607ef79ecbab1d6ccdf0c4deaf8a2ede3b OP_EQUAL
address
3CXJLPd48N4fPXsUqiusERKNUbgyWHpV8Y
transaction
24012b32bc43096e58a8af882bd2e2a43c0cf2448ee739998eb7ecf3994e3cf1
confirmations
303071
spent
true